For those that know me, I recently sold my VT, and this is the new pride and joy :)
I don't have massive plans at the moment, just a few smaller things that I want to fix up to make her look a bit more classier. Perhaps down the track I'll look at more serious engine mods.

Name: Dave

Age: 19

Model: 1990 series 1 VQ statesman

Colour: Atlas Grey (original paint)

Engine: 5L v8

Gearbox: 4 speed auto

Odometer: 140xxx (genuine with log book)

Exhaust: HSV headers, stock cat, 2.5" with rear muffler removed (for now)

Brakes: Stock

Suspension: King Spring SSL's

Wheels: 17x7 WM statesman

Interior: Dark blue velour

Future Mods:

SSL's in the back to match the front
Remove rear mudflaps

CAI
Pacemakers, twin cats, Y pipe, 3"
Tune


Other Info: 2 genuine owners, both elderly. Log book. Paid $6450 on the 17th of December. Came with years rego and RWC.

how you gonna drive a 5l on green p's mate? :lock:

VicRoads will facilitate exemption permits to be granted by letter, upon application, for the following vehicle types:
1. Hight powered Vehicles with a power to weight ratio of less than 100kW per tonne;
2. Hight powered Vehicles with a power to weight ratio between 100kW and 125kW per tonne and that are considered to be a family-type vehicle rather than a sports-type vehicle.

You work off 125kw/per ton or 3.5L/per ton, therefore with an estimated weight of 1563kg it would work out to:

125x1.563= 195.375kw (max engine output) - Standard output: 165 kW @ 4400 RPM

or

3.5x1.563= 5.4705L (max engine capacity) - Standard capacity: 4.987L
